0

我没有做太多 PHP,但我看到了这个名为Tank Auth for Code Ignitor 的库,它看起来很有希望。我正在尝试在我的项目中使用它,但我遇到了一些问题。遵循所有安装说明(数量不多)后,我尝试注册用户。当我提交注册表时,屏幕上会出现几个警告。

他们中的大多数是这样的:

消息:date() [function.date]:依赖系统的时区设置是不安全的。您需要使用 date.timezone 设置或 date_default_timezone_set() 函数。如果您使用了这些方法中的任何一种,但仍然收到此警告,您很可能拼错了时区标识符。我们为“MDT/-6.0/DST”选择了“美国/丹佛”

另一个是这样的:

消息:无法修改标头信息 - 标头已发送(输出开始于 /Users/Nick/Sites/HoneyDo/system/core/Exceptions.php:170)

尽管有上述消息,但确认电子邮件仍会发送到我的收件箱。确认电子邮件包含一个链接,基本上说单击此处确认注册。但是,当我这样做时,页面只会显示“您输入的激活码不正确或已过期”。

有没有人使用这个看到这些问题?

谢谢!

4

1 回答 1

2

在调用 date() 之前,我添加了对 date_default_timezone_set() 函数的调用。设置我的时区后,错误消失了。默认时区

于 2011-07-01T15:16:35.800 回答